Works perfectly for Icom IC-705
This cable requests 15 volts from your USB-C PD power source, then it's up to the power source what to do with the request. I have one battery that supports 15 V and the radio reports 15.2 V. I have another power bank that does not support 15 V but does support 12 V, and the radio reports 12.2 V. This cable does exactly what it claims but is only as good as the power source you attach it to.

Shows 15V but outputs 9V (my bad)
I purchased 2x of the 15V version. Package and plug print shows 15V but both of them are only outputting 9V. I tested with several PSUs and with and without load, never got more than 9V.Update: I just upgraded from 2 to 5 stars as it was a user error. I didn’t realize Apple USB-C PSUs don’t support the 15v profile, it worked using another power supply.
